+struct btOverlapCallback
+{
+virtual ~btOverlapCallback()
+{
+}
+ //return true for deletion of the pair
+ virtual bool processOverlap(btBroadphasePair& pair) = 0;
+};
+
+///btOverlappingPairCache maintains the objects with overlapping AABB
+///Typically managed by the Broadphase, Axis3Sweep or btSimpleBroadphase
+class btOverlappingPairCache : public btBroadphaseInterface
+{
+ //avoid brute-force finding all the time
+ std::set<btBroadphasePair> m_overlappingPairSet;
+
+ //during the dispatch, check that user doesn't destroy/create proxy
+ bool m_blockedForChanges;
+
+ public:
+
+ btOverlappingPairCache();
+ virtual ~btOverlappingPairCache();
+
+ void processAllOverlappingPairs(btOverlapCallback*);
+
+ void removeOverlappingPair(btBroadphasePair& pair);
+
+ void cleanOverlappingPair(btBroadphasePair& pair);
+
+ void addOverlappingPair(btBroadphaseProxy* proxy0,btBroadphaseProxy* proxy1);
+
+ btBroadphasePair* findPair(btBroadphaseProxy* proxy0,btBroadphaseProxy* proxy1);
+
+
+ void cleanProxyFromPairs(btBroadphaseProxy* proxy);
+
+ void removeOverlappingPairsContainingProxy(btBroadphaseProxy* proxy);
+
+
+ inline bool needsBroadphaseCollision(btBroadphaseProxy* proxy0,btBroadphaseProxy* proxy1) const
+ {
+ bool collides = proxy0->m_collisionFilterGroup & proxy1->m_collisionFilterMask;
+ collides = collides && (proxy1->m_collisionFilterGroup & proxy0->m_collisionFilterMask);
+
+ return collides;
+ }
+
+
+
+ virtual void refreshOverlappingPairs() =0;
+
+
+
+
+};
+#endif //OVERLAPPING_PAIR_CACHE_H
